Iley Froehlich is a PhD student in interdisciplinary anthropology and a research assistant at the Chair of Fundamental Theology and Philosophical Anthropology at the University of Freiburg. His research focuses on trans- and posthumanism, philosophical anthropology, philosophy of technology, and bioethics. He studied psychology and political science (BA) as well as interdisciplinary anthropology at the Universities of Hagen, Hanover, and Freiburg.
